Axil Espresso wins ASCA Nationwide Espresso Championships – hospitality


Melbourne-based barista Jack Simpson of Axil Espresso has taken out the highest spot on the ASCA Nationwide Espresso Championships for the second yr in a row.

It’s the third win in a row for Melbourne’s Axil Espresso, and makes it a complete of six wins for the model because the competitors’s launch in 2006.

As Australia Barista Champion, Simpson will symbolize the nation on the World Barista Championship in South Korea this Might.

Final yr, Simpson positioned third within the World Barista Championship.

“It’s an honour to be topped the 2024 Australian Barista Champion, and I’m extraordinarily grateful for the unwavering help and coaching that Axil Espresso have given me all through the method of making, designing and researching these three specialty espresso drinks,” says Simpson.

“This yr I had an entire new perspective and method to the competitors, I’m actually happy with the way in which I used to be capable of showcase my ever-evolving espresso making type, and the work of the Axil staff. I’m thrilled to have the ability to symbolize Australia on the world stage in Might.”

As a part of the judging course of, Simpson offered an espresso, milk-based espresso, and coffee-based signature drink.

For the coffee-based signature drink Simpson teamed up with bartender Sam Thornhill to current a tipple which used a rotary evaporator to separate peach juice into honey and hydrosalt, which was then mixed with the fermentation of konoto, and served with a peach and marigold flower aroma cloud.

For his showcase, Simpson used Geisha and Pacamara coffees.

Simpson will compete within the World Barista Championship in South Korea from 1-4 Might 2024.
